CH fine, the HW works only when I set the temperature high but once it reaches temperature and the boiler stops firing the water turns cold
It has a new diverter valve and a new Honeywell controller.
So when the hot water tap is opened and the hot water is up to temperature the water runs cold quicky and the boiler does not fire.

Identify the terminals from the flow switch and test each one to a neutral before switching on a tap. The one that is live is the feed to the switch. When you have identified that one, switch on the water and test the other terminal to neutral. If it doesn't show a feed, then the switch is faulty. For further test, isolate the power and bridge the two terminals. Turn off the CH demand, turn the DHW thermostat down and switch the boiler back on. If the burner fires, you have proved a faulty switch.
